An investigation of the radiative processes for a collection of N two-state atoms strongly coupled to the field of a high-finesse optical cavity is presented. Observations of the spectral response of the composite system to weak external modulation reveal a coupling-induced normal-mode splitting. Linewidth averaging leads to linewidths below the free-space atomic width.
